'Hangout With Yoo' Yu Jae-seok was betrayed by his colleagues and paid the bill alone.
The March 21 broadcast of MBC variety show 'Hangout With Yoo' (directed by Kim Jin-yong, Lee Joo-won, Kim Ki-ho, An Ji-seon, Bang Seong-su, Park Eun-jin / writer No Min-seon) was presented as the "country boys' heyday — war of money 2 in Gimhae" episode featuring Yu Jae-seok, HaHa, Heo Kyunghwan, Joo Woo-jae and Yang Sang-guk. The five men, who visited Yang Sang-guk's hometown of Gimhae in Gyeongsangnam-do, delivered big laughs once again as they staged a "war of money" full of suspicion and betrayal.
The broadcast recorded a 4.8% household rating in the Seoul metropolitan area, ranking first in its time slot. The key channel competitiveness indicator reflecting changes in media consumption, the 20-54 rating, was 2.9%, continuing its run as the top program in its time slot and among Saturday variety shows. The top moment of the show was when Yu Jae-seok and HaHa finally ate rice and meat together after rice orders were blocked by the Gyeongsang-do style "meat first, rice later," with the minute peak rating rising to 6.6%. (Nielsen Korea, Seoul metropolitan area)

The final stop was the beef-ribs restaurant Yang Sang-guk frequented as a child. The five men's promise, "Let's not talk about money here," was broken when it came time to pay. HaHa pressured Yu Jae-seok, saying, "If you don't pay here, you're not a man," and Yu Jae-seok, abandoning pride, defended himself, "I'm not a man!" A fierce battle of wits even broke out over who would go to the restroom. While HaHa was in the restroom, Yu Jae-seok attempted to escape but was hit by a splash of water thrown by HaHa. It turned out HaHa had faked toilet sounds to set a trap.
The five men, who had been bickering, ultimately proceeded with one last fateful bet, and HaHa won. However, thinking filming had ended, HaHa went to the restroom and when he returned the bill was handed to Yu Jae-seok. Under Joo Woo-jae's lead, the group canceled the payment and all ran away. Yu Jae-seok, helplessly betrayed by his colleagues, paid the 180,000-won meal bill alone. The ending, with HaHa, Heo Kyunghwan, Joo Woo-jae and Yang Sang-guk running away shouting, "For Jinyoung's local economy the national MC has to pay once," and "It's not over until it's over. Jae-seok, brother, enjoy your meal!" and Yu Jae-seok getting soaked, betrayed and stuck with the bill, left viewers laughing.
